#3d5fdf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d5fdf is composed of 23.9% red, 37.3%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 57.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 227.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 55.7%. #3d5fdf color hex could be obtained by blending #7abeff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3d5fdf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010308 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d5fdf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8c91 is the less saturated color, while #2350f9 is the most saturated one.
